Skip to main content

Andrej Karpathy Skills

Plugin Verified Active

Behavioral guidelines to reduce common LLM coding mistakes, derived from Andrej Karpathy's observations on LLM coding pitfalls

1 Skill 0 MCPs
Purpose

To help users improve LLM code generation by providing clear principles to avoid common mistakes like overcomplication, incorrect assumptions, and surgical errors.

Features

  • Provides four core principles for better LLM coding: Think Before Coding, Simplicity First, Surgical Changes, and Goal-Driven Execution.
  • Offers detailed explanations and actionable advice for each principle.
  • Can be used as a Claude Code plugin or directly via a CLAUDE.md file.
  • Includes guidance on defining success criteria for LLM tasks.

Use Cases

  • When generating new code with an LLM to ensure it follows best practices from the start.
  • When reviewing code produced by an LLM to identify potential pitfalls.
  • When refactoring existing code to maintain simplicity and avoid unnecessary changes.
  • When working on projects where consistent, high-quality code output from LLMs is crucial.

Non-Goals

  • Providing language-specific linting or code formatting rules.
  • Automating code execution or deployment processes.
  • Acting as a general-purpose LLM prompt engineering tool beyond coding practices.

Installation

First, add the marketplace

/plugin marketplace add forrestchang/andrej-karpathy-skills
/plugin install andrej-karpathy-skills@karpathy-skills

Quality Score

Verified
99 /100
Analyzed 6 days ago

Trust Signals

Last commit29 days ago
Stars128.1k
LicenseMIT
Status
View Source

Similar Extensions

Context7 Plugin

100

Upstash Context7 MCP server for up-to-date documentation lookup. Pull version-specific documentation and code examples directly from source repositories into your LLM context.

Plugin
upstash

LLM Wiki

99

Turn Claude Code + Obsidian into a second brain. The LLM incrementally ingests sources into a persistent, interlinked markdown wiki — building entity/concept/source pages, flagging contradictions, maintaining an index and log. Knowledge compounds instead of being re-derived by RAG on every query. Inspired by Karpathy's LLM Wiki gist. Ships SKILL, 3 sub-agents, 5 slash commands, 8 Python tools (stdlib only), full vault templates, and cross-tool compatibility (Claude Code, Codex CLI, Cursor, Antigravity, OpenCode, Gemini CLI).

Plugin
alirezarezvani

Framework Migration

99

Framework updates, migration planning, and architectural transformation workflows

Plugin
wshobson

Dimensional Analysis

99

Annotates codebases with dimensional analysis comments documenting units, dimensions, and decimal scaling. Use when someone asks to annotate units in a codebase, perform a dimensional analysis, or find vulnerabilities in a DeFi protocol. Prevents dimensional mismatches and catches formula bugs early.

Plugin
trailofbits

Codebase Cleanup

98

Technical debt reduction, dependency updates, and code refactoring automation

Plugin
wshobson

Brand Voice

92

Brand Voice transforms scattered brand materials into enforceable AI guardrails — automatically. It searches across Notion, Google Drive, Confluence, Gong, Slack, and meeting transcripts to distill your strongest brand signals into a single source of truth, then applies them to every piece of AI-generated content. The more your team creates with Claude, the more consistent your brand becomes.

Plugin
anthropics

© 2025 SkillRepo · Find the right skill, skip the noise.